		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Before Paul Decolator passed away Pleased Youth got to play a reunion show at the Court Tavern.  After that show we discussed finally releasing the unreleased LP from 1983. If any labels out there are interested get in touch with me.  The unreleased album is much more hardcore than the later Dangerous Choo Choo LP.  Being in Pleased Youth was a great deal of fun and we got to play some insane shows (anyone remember Suicidal Tendencies at New York South?).</p>

		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Glad to see that Greg Walker is still around. He was a kick-ass drummer and a really great guy, too bad he&#8217;s not playing anymore.<br />
Pleased Youth were a really good band, I used to see them playing around New Brunswick all the time. Sluggo and Decolator had a killer two guitar wall of sound. A very cool band.</p>
